设计优秀的iPhone应用:Tapworthy

需积分: 10 2 下载量 191 浏览量 更新于2024-07-22 收藏 15.11MB PDF 举报
"Tapworthy - Designing Great iPhone Apps" 是一本由 Josh Clark 撰写的书籍,专注于 iOS 应用程序的用户界面设计。这本书旨在帮助开发者和设计师创建出优秀的 iPhone 应用,提高用户体验。 内容概述: "Tapworthy" 一书深入探讨了为 iPhone 设计出色应用的关键要素。书中涵盖了多个主题,包括但不限于以下几点: 1. **理解用户**:设计应始终以用户为中心,考虑他们的需求、习惯和期望。书中强调了进行用户研究和测试的重要性,以确保设计能够满足目标受众。 2. **触摸界面设计**:iPhone 的主要交互方式是触摸,因此设计者需要了解如何创建直观且易于操作的触摸界面。书中详细讨论了按钮、手势和其他触摸元素的最佳实践。 3. **导航与布局**:有效的应用导航是用户体验的关键。书中介绍了各种导航模式,如底部标签栏、侧滑菜单等,以及如何根据应用内容和结构选择合适的布局策略。 4. **视觉设计**:设计不仅仅是功能,视觉美学同样重要。"Tapworthy" 讨论了色彩、图标、字体和整体风格在塑造应用品牌和用户体验中的作用。 5. **反馈与提示**:良好的反馈让用户知道他们的操作已被系统接收并处理。书中提到了如何通过动画、声音和视觉变化提供清晰的反馈,以增强用户的信心和满意度。 6. **性能优化**:快速响应和流畅的操作是优秀应用的标志。书中的部分章节将讨论如何通过减少延迟、优化加载时间和避免复杂交互来提升应用性能。 7. **适应性和可扩展性**:随着 iOS 平台的发展,设计必须具备适应性,以应对新的设备尺寸、操作系统版本和用户需求。书中可能涵盖如何设计可扩展的界面,以适应未来的变化。 8. **可用性原则**:遵循普遍的可用性原则,如一致性、简洁性和错误预防,可以显著提高应用的易用性。书中会讲解这些原则,并给出如何在实际设计中应用的建议。 9. **案例研究**:为了使理论更生动,书中可能会包含实际应用的设计案例,分析其成功或失败的原因,为读者提供借鉴。 通过阅读 "Tapworthy",开发者和设计师不仅可以获得设计原则的理论知识,还能学习到将这些原则应用于实际项目的方法。这本书对于希望在 iOS 平台上创建出引人入胜、易于使用的应用程序的人来说,是一本宝贵的资源。